In jazz and blues music, a “blue” note is a note that is sung or played at a slightly different pitch for expressive purposes. Blue notes stand out from regular notes and are often especially emotive. They are thought to have originated in traditional African work songs. The blue note is technically neither in the major key nor minor key. Instead, it has a tonality that is somewhere in the middle of the two. For instance, when playing in the key of E, a musician typically plays or sings either the G or G?. The blue note, by contrast, would be between G and G?, or would move between them. Often times, the blue note bears an aural similarity to a minor chord, but is played or sung over a group of major chords. This results in a distinctively dissonant sound. It is this sound that has led some to refer to the blue note as the “worried” note.
